Spanish variety in sync with Chinese cotton spinners

Its a rare compliment from China for grower of cotton in far away Spain.

An appreciation which saw Spanish cotton demand rise during 2005-06 seasons as Chinese spinners continued to purchase high quality Spanish crop.

Reporting the sale of large quantity early in the season, October exports were 24,781 bales, a 63.4 percent year-on-year rise from the previous year.

Needless to say, main export destination for Spanish cotton was China, which consumed 16,667 bales.

During August-October period, exports volume was up 25.2 percent at 70,007 bales, and this time again, China topped the export destination with 31,202 bales.
